What This Role Actually Is
This is not a “run the slides and post the sermon” job.
This is a part-time creative leadership role (approximately 50 hours per month) focused on how people experience West—both in the room and online.
People experience church long before they ever show up.
Attention is earned, not assumed.
Digital is not secondary—it is central to how we reach people.
This role is designed to help West expand its reach, tell better stories, and create meaningful experiences that connect with people beyond Sunday.
Role Weighting and Focus
This role is intentionally weighted:
70% Content Creation, Storytelling, and Digital Engagement
30% Sunday Production and Technical Oversight
This is not a production-first role. It is a content and engagement role that includes production responsibilities.
Time and Scope Expectations
This role averages approximately 50 hours per month and includes:
· Sunday presence (4–5 hours weekly) to oversee production and experience (approx. 2x a month)
· Flexible midweek hours for content creation, editing, and planning
· Monthly planning and storytelling development
· Monthly staff meeting
The schedule is flexible (other than Sunday mornings), but outcomes are not.
Key Responsibilities
Content Strategy and Creation (Primary Focus)
· Develop and execute a consistent weekly content pipeline
· Turn each sermon into multiple pieces of content, including:
- 2–3 short-form videos (Reels, Shorts, etc.)
- 1 quote or graphic
- 1 midweek engagement post
· Manage posting across platforms (Instagram, Facebook, YouTube)
· Ensure content is consistent, timely, and aligned with West’s voice
· Develop Podcast w/ the pastor and West leaders, publish podcast
Storytelling and Media Development
· Capture and produce stories of life change and community impact
· Highlight ministries such as Amped, Back to School Bash, Soul Creations, and outreach efforts
· Create short-form and occasional long-form video content
· Help shift communication from announcements to stories
Digital Engagement
· Strengthen how people engage with West online by creating relevant content
· Support livestream experience and basic engagement strategies
· Contribute to building an online experience that feels relational, not passive
Experience Design (Sundays and Beyond)
· Shape the flow of weekly worship services
· Design the first few minutes of the experience with intentionality
· Integrate video, storytelling, and creative elements into services
· Identify and remove friction points in the experience
Production Leadership (Support Role – Not Primary)
· Oversee Sunday production, including slides, video elements, and coordination of audio and lighting
· Prepare all service media in advance
· Ensure services run smoothly and without distraction
· Lead and schedule volunteers for media and production roles
Innovation and Improvement
· Continually evaluate what is working and what is not
· Introduce new ideas, tools, and formats where appropriate
· Stay current with trends in digital communication and engagement
Non-Negotiables
· Weekly content is created and published consistently
· Sunday services are prepared and executed without avoidable issues
· Stories of impact are captured regularly
· The role focuses on reaching people beyond those already attending
